
Rolex takes the top third year in a row & Cartier surprises us

CHRONEXT, the leading e-commerce company for luxury watches, releases a ranking of last year's top 10 models based on its sales in 2018. The leader Rolex is even more in demand than in the 2017 annual ranking and not only occupies four out of ten possible places, but also the first three: "The limited availability of Rolex last year makes the brand even more interesting for many enthusiasts," comments Philipp Man, CEO and founder of CHRONEXT.
Omega remains Rolex's strongest competitor
Omega remains Rolex's strongest competitor and NOMOS Glashütte is establishing itself in the ranking. The Cartier Tank Solo is a special surprise because for the first time ever, a women's model is also among the top 10. "Luxury watches have long since ceased to be a matter purely for men," says Philipp Man. "The female target group is becoming increasingly important for us, as our figures prove.”
1. Rolex Submariner Date
There are very few watches that compare to the Submariner Date. Thanks to its unmistakable design and legendary reputation, the model has been celebrated for decades as one of the best watches in history. The Submariner that is up to 300 meter water resistant is the epitome of sporty elegance and appears appropriate and stylish in every situation.

2. Rolex Datejust
Missing the top 10 in the 2017 annual ranking, the diverse Datejust collection redeemed itself quickly to the top in the 2018 semi-annual ranking. Unlike any other watch, the Datejust embodies timeless elegance. Since 1945, this simple model with its characteristic date display has convinced generations of watch lovers.

3. Rolex GMT-Master II
Ranked fourth in the 2017 annual ranking, the GMT Master II climbs to third place with its classic yet sporty and elegant design.The model makes it possible to read three time zones simultaneously. The GMT Master II was first presented to the public in 1985 and has been one of Rolex's most coveted models ever since.

4. TAG Heuer Formula 1
Sportiness and functionality unite in the TAG Formula 1 collection to form a unique combination. Whether with quartz movement or automatic caliber - all models have one thing in common: the "Swiss Made" rating, high quality workmanship and impressive robustness.

5. Omega Speedmaster Moonwatch Professional
Moonwatch, Speedy - the legendary Omega chronograph has several nicknames. The watch series also includes many special models, with which Omega captivates the history of the Speedmaster in manned space travel and the first moon landing.

6. Omega Seamaster Diver 300 M
A legend among diving watches, the Omega Seamaster Diver 300 M combines proven design with state-of-the-art watch technology. Robust and strong in character, these watches have always been among the company's most popular models thanks to their exceptional quality and legendary design. The Omega Seamaster 300 took first place in the 2017 annual ranking.

7. Breitling Superocean II 42
The Breitling Superocean on the wrist opens the way to the dark blue depths of the ocean and the fascinating world of fine watchmaking. The sporty and functional design of the Breitling Superocean II 42 is loved by professional divers and recreational divers alike.

8. Rolex Cosmograph Daytona
The Rolex Cosmograph Daytona takes eighth place. It is known for its enormous increase in value, in particular the steel model. The Daytona has been equipped with its own chronograph movement since 2000. In recent decades, the Daytona has developed into a true cult object.

9. NOMOS Glashütte Tangente
Nomos Glashütte's flagship model: The Tangente manifests the incomparable clarity, restrained elegance and precision that make Nomos Glashütte's style so unique. First introduced in 1992, the Tangente became a design classic.

10. Cartier Tank Solo
A true legend in the world of luxury watches. With its rectangular shape, the Cartier Tank finds its inspiration in the shape of military tanks - a design that is also reflected in the model name. Launched in 1917, it found its place on the wrists of numerous celebrities such as Audrey Hepburn and Angelina Jolie and is now considered one of the most important watch models in the world.
